Auto-PAP Machine

Postby forumadmin on Tue Apr 19, 2005 12:45 pm

An Auto-PAP or Self-Adjusting CPAP is similar to a CPAP or Bi-level PAP machines, in general use, but the devices difference is that it will sense a snore or an apnea and automatically increase the pressure to stop the snoring or apnea.

Computer software is available for Auto-PAP machines, which will allow a user or clinician to download the data recorded onto a PC. This data can be put in report form to track treatment results.
